#ifndef __UTIL_DECODE_DER_H__
#define __UTIL_DECODE_DER_H__
#define ASN1_CLASS_UNIVERSAL 0
#define ASN1_CLASS_APPLICATION 1
#define ASN1_CLASS_CONTEXTSPEC 2
#define ASN1_CLASS_PRIVATE 3
#define ASN1_UNKNOWN 0
#define ASN1_BOOLEAN 0x01
#define ASN1_INTEGER 0x02
#define ASN1_BITSTRING 0x03
#define ASN1_OCTETSTRING 0x04
#define ASN1_NULL 0x05
#define ASN1_OID 0x06
#define ASN1_UTF8STRING 0x0c
#define ASN1_SEQUENCE 0x10
#define ASN1_SET 0x11
#define ASN1_PRINTSTRING 0x13
#define ASN1_T61STRING 0x14
#define ASN1_IA5STRING 0x16
#define ASN1_UTCTIME 0x17
typedef struct Asn1ElementType_ {
uint8_t cls:2;
uint8_t pc:1;
uint8_t tag:5;
} __attribute__((packed)) Asn1ElementType;
/* Generic ASN.1 element
* Presence and meaning of fields depends on the header and type values.
*/
typedef struct Asn1Generic_ {
Asn1ElementType header;
uint8_t type;
uint32_t length; /* length of node, including header */
struct Asn1Generic_ *data; /* only if type is structured */
char *str;
uint32_t strlen;
uint64_t value;
struct Asn1Generic_ *next; /* only if type is sequence */
} Asn1Generic;
/* Generic error */
#define ERR_DER_GENERIC 0x01
/* Unknown ASN.1 element type */
#define ERR_DER_UNKNOWN_ELEMENT 0x02
/* One element requires to read more bytes than available */
#define ERR_DER_ELEMENT_SIZE_TOO_BIG 0x03
/* One element size is invalid (more than 4 bytes long) */
#define ERR_DER_INVALID_SIZE 0x04
/* Unsupported string type */
#define ERR_DER_UNSUPPORTED_STRING 0x05
/* Missing field or element */
#define ERR_DER_MISSING_ELEMENT 0x06
Asn1Generic * DecodeDer(const unsigned char *buffer, uint32_t size, uint32_t *errcode);
void DerFree(Asn1Generic *a);
#endif /* __UTIL_DECODE_DER_H__ */
